Late game doubles from the bottom half of the lineup fueled New Mexico in a 6-5 win over No. 7 Texas Tech on Wednesday afternoon.
While the bullpen was dominant in the final contest of the two-game midweek series, the Lobos’ win was highlighted in walk-off fashion.
UNM’s offense was dormant for the majority of the contest, but thanks to clutch extra-base hits by pinch hitter Michael Eaton and Dalton Bowers, the Lobos were able to avoid a season sweep at the hands of the Red Raiders (30-10).
Slugger Chris DeVito got the Lobos going in the bottom of the ninth inning with a one-out double to right field to set up Michael Eaton.
